Description
We can't overreact mid-season and trade for guys with a few months left on their deal. Upgrades can be done during the summer

Glendening's faceoff % is 68.4, the best in the league, and Holland is familiar with him (probably drafted him too, I'd guess). He's right handed, and can kill penalties. This will take a load off Drai

Iaffolo is speedy and can score goals. Janmark and Iaffolo are the only options I see in free agency for McDavid's wing. I'm not sure about Hoffman anymore because he's in his 30's, he doesn't have speed. This is assuming Nuge stays with Drai and Yamo. Someone needs to play with McD and Pulju, it can't be Neal

Getzlaf is a great veteran centerman, still around 50% FOW. Can still score like a 3C. Might supply some of what Spezza in Toronto does

Jones is a legit top 2 defenseman. He's having a down season so his value is lower but the risk is high. I wouldn't mind taking a chance on him although the trade is highly unlikely to happen

Keep a 1A/1B setup in net at least till Koski is gone. Probably want to hire a goaltending department and a new goalie coach eventually. Teams can have good goaltending without spending a lot
